Lemon- Meyer lemon is preferred, but others work for this recipe.Noni fruit- The secret ingredient that makes this raw goat cheese alternative possible.Sea salt- Extra minerals and the right balance of flavor for this predominantly tangy cheese.Macadamia nuts- High in heart-healthy fats for richness.The clean and simple list of ingredients is evident in the snowy color and pure, tangy taste of this whole food, plant-based indulgence. Cheese can be frozen and thawed without compromising taste or texture, unlike other cheeses.Creamy, thick texture from naturally rich macadamia nuts. Cultured cheese flavor without the wait time.Made without any thickening agents like agar powder or tapioca starch.No chalky tofu or interfering flavors from nutritional yeast, apple cider vinegar, or coconut oil.
